  • Abstract
    This paper studies key management, a fundamental problem in securing mobile ad hoc networks (MANETs). We present the key management scheme as a combination of identity-based and threshold cryptography for ad hoc networks. It is a certificateless solution which eliminates the need for public key distribution and certificates in conventional public key management schemes. With the lower cost of computation and communication, our scheme is efficient, secure and especially suitable for mobile ad hoc networks characterized by distributed computing, dynamic topology and multi-hop communications.
